78.56 percent of the population in 77587 drive to work alone. 0.18 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 57.34 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 9.55 percent of the residents in 77587 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.97 members with about 2.27 cars available per household.
An estimate of 69.45 percent of the residents in 77587 has some form of health insurance. 33.79 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 39.94 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 77587 would have to travel an average of 10.45 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Hca Houston Healthcare Clear Lake .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 77587, South Houston, Texas.

As of , an estimate of 16,381 residents live in 77587 with a median age of 29.7 years. 33.00 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 8.65 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 37.91 percent of the residents in 77587 is currently married, and 25.05 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 77587 is $4,917.67.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 77587 is approximately $946. The median household spends about 19.24 percent of their income on housing.
